Prolonged Atmospheric River Will Impact the Northwest Early this Week

A weather system in the Pacific Northwest will produce rain throughout the day, before a potent atmospheric river produces a prolonged round of heavy rainfall, widespread urban and river flooding, and high elevation snow to the region Monday through Wednesday. Detailed Forecast

Tonight
A chance of sprinkles before 2am, then a slight chance of rain between 2am and 4am, then a chance of rain and snow after 4am. Mostly cloudy, with a low around 31. Calm wind becoming north northeast around 5 mph after midnight. Chance of precipitation is 30%.
Monday
Snow, possibly mixed with rain before 2pm, then a chance of snow between 2pm and 5pm, then a chance of flurries after 5pm. Patchy fog before 2pm. Temperature falling to around 31 by 9am. North northeast wind around 6 mph. Chance of precipitation is 80%. New snow accumulation of 1 to 2 inches possible.
Monday Night
Cloudy, then gradually becoming partly cloudy, with a low around 24. Calm wind.
Tuesday
Mostly sunny, with a high near 46. Calm wind becoming southwest 5 to 8 mph in the morning. Winds could gust as high as 16 mph.
Tuesday Night
Mostly cloudy, with a low around 35. South southwest wind 7 to 10 mph, with gusts as high as 24 mph.
Wednesday
A 30 percent chance of rain after 1pm. Mostly cloudy, with a high near 52.
Wednesday Night
A 50 percent chance of rain, mainly before 1am. Mostly cloudy, with a low around 31.
Thursday
A 50 percent chance of rain. Mostly cloudy, with a high near 41.
Thursday Night
Rain likely before 1am, then a chance of rain and snow. Mostly cloudy, with a low around 28. Chance of precipitation is 70%.
Friday
A chance of rain and snow. Partly sunny, with a high near 37. Chance of precipitation is 40%.
Friday Night
A 50 percent chance of snow. Mostly cloudy, with a low around 15.
Saturday
A 20 percent chance of snow. Partly sunny, with a high near 28.
Saturday Night
A 20 percent chance of snow. Mostly cloudy, with a low around 15.
Sunday
Mostly sunny, with a high near 29.
